Finding Time for Self-Care in a Busy World

Caring for yourself is one of the most important gifts you can give. When you take time to appreciate who you are, it becomes easier to understand your own worth.

This sense of worth can guide you in choosing relationships that respect and value you, as well as help you find balance in your day-to-day life.


Understanding Your Own Worth

When you know you are worthy of kindness, patience, and understanding, you won’t settle for anything less. Recognizing your worth makes it clearer who deserves a place in your life and who may not.

This doesn’t mean you have to remove all challenging relationships—it simply means you can set boundaries to ensure you’re treated with respect.


Balancing Care for Yourself and Others

It can feel natural to put everyone else’s needs first, but remember that giving too much without caring for yourself can leave you feeling drained. By meeting your own needs, you build a stronger foundation for helping others.

When your own “cup” is full, it’s easier to share love, understanding, and support with friends, family, and anyone else who matters to you.


Finding Time in a Busy Schedule

Modern life is often packed with responsibilities. Between work, family, and community, it might seem impossible to carve out time for yourself.

Yet, even a few quiet moments can make a big difference.

Try waking up a few minutes earlier to enjoy a peaceful cup of tea, or use a break in your day to breathe and refocus. Over time, these small acts can help you stay grounded.


Simple Acts of Self-Care

There are many ways to care for yourself. Consider some of these ideas:

  1. Daily Quiet Time: Spend a few minutes each morning or evening reflecting on the day and calming your mind.
  2. Gentle Movement: A short walk, a few stretches, or simple breathing exercises can help you feel refreshed.

  4. Mindful Moments: Pause before starting a task to appreciate the present moment. This helps bring a sense of peace and intention to your actions.

 

These small steps can add up, gradually filling your life with moments of calm and self-appreciation.
